Use the electronic zoom

When displaying images on a 1-screen, it is possible to enlarge the displayed live images using the electronic
zoom. It is also possible to move the area of the enlarged image to be displayed.

Step 1

Press the [SUB MENU] button.
→ The submenu window will be displayed.

Step 2

Move the cursor onto [El-zoom], and then press the
[SET] button.
→ Images will be displayed at x2 and the El-zoom

panel will be displayed.

Step 3

When the [SET] button is pressed, images will be dis-
played at x4.
Each time the [SET] button is pressed, the zoom fac-
tor will change as follows.
x4 → x1 → x2

Note:

• When the zoom factor is x2 or x4, it is possible to

move the area of the enlarged image to be dis-
played by pressing the arrows button (

C, D, A,

B).


When monitor 2 is being selected
Each time the [OSD] button is pressed, display of

the camera title and the status bar will change as
follows.

Display the camera title and hide the status bar →

Hide the camera title and display the status bar →
Hide both the camera title and the status bar →
Display both the camera title and the status bar
